Sana'a International Airport has been non-operational for more than a decade due to a humanitarian blockade imposed by the enemy, leading to severe suffering for both the living and the deceased. The blockade hampers patients' travel abroad for treatment, cuts off opportunities for Yemenis to study and work, and results in a deterioration of humanitarian and economic conditions, increasing suffering. Reopening the airport is an imperative necessity to save lives, reconnect with the world, and restore hope, as its continued closure deepens isolation and constitutes a condemnation of the human right to life.
